Mortgage lending activity on the rise as homeowners shop for the best deals

Refinancing activity is continuing to surge as the Official Cash Rate continues to fall. 

Latest Centrix figures show mortgage enquiries are up 16% for the month of July and new mortgage lending rose almost 25%.

Chief Operating Officer Monika Lacey says the market is active at the moment and people are keen to get the best deal they can. 

She told Mike Hosking that about 36% of fixed mortgages are set to roll off in the next six months, so that’s quite a bit of activity that will start to flow through.

Lacey says it should result in a bit more cash in people’s pockets.
